Job Description We are looking for an Operating Room (OR) Nurse to join PSI as a Clinical Trial Liaison!
In this role, a Clinical Trial Liaison:
Acts as a specialized liaison to assist sites with a protocol-tailored approach to increase efficiency of the patient identification and recruitment process
Assists sites in developing and implementing patient enrollment techniques
Coordinates site specific patient recruitment and retention plans observing the planned metrics
Provides information specific to the area of expertise to site team members involved in patient recruitment
Identifies, tracks, and reports patient enrollment progress throughout the study
Analyses the protocol in order to provide the site with the support needed to improve the patient pathway
Provides support to the project teams to ensure proper documentation of study-specific assessments related to patient enrollment
Assists and advises the site monitor in the area of patient enrollment
This role requires travel.
Qualifications
Registered Nurse (RN) Degree
A minimum of 5 years of experience as an OR Nurse
